Halsey Announces World Tour
Halsey has announced a world tour!She is starting in April in Australia & New Zealand with special guest Kehlani, then continues in North America with Jessie Reyez. Panic! At The Disco Release “Death Of A Bachelor” Live Video’s
Panic! At The Disco’s live album “All My Friends, We’re Glorious: Death Of A Bachelor Tour Live” released on the 15th of December. Spencer Smith (Ex-Panic! At The Disco) Is Now Working At Pete Wentz’ Label
Ex-Panic! At The Disco drummer Spencer Smith has found himself an official role at Fall Out Boy’s Pete Wentz’ record label. The two shared a photo last night in which they shared the news.
